A Development Of An Intelligent Mobile Application Intergrated Smart Energy Meters Through Iot

Abstract: Existing website, mobile application developed by distribution companies having no options of displaying daily electrical energy consumption details. Apart, monthly electricity bill is calculated wrongly and the billing amount rises much which is highly irritable to the consumers. This issue has been sort out through the mobile application invented here. This mobile application integrated with the smart energy meters installed at the consumers end and hence the various parameters measured by the smart meters such as current, voltage, power, energy, power factor, maximum demand are transferred to the mobile application instantaneously through Internet of Things (IoT) Therefore, the consumers can read/know the electricity consumption and bill hourly or daily basis. Apart, this application gives the provision of setting the maximum limit of electricity consumption reached, and then the application will alert the consumers so as the usage can be minimized by consumers. This ensures the possible energy savings in the utility side. Since the application gives the hourly data to the consumers, the electricity bill and other data are transparent to them and it is drastically preventing the conflict between consumers and power distribution companies. Therefore, power distribution companies can satisfy their consumers by promoting energy savings, providing transparency and preventing the conflict through this mobile application.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ION
The field of this invention relates to electronics and more particularly in the Development of an Intelligent Mobile Application Integrated with Smart Energy Meter through IOT for domestic and industrial applications.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
This invention relates to the Development of an Intelligent Mobile Application Integrated with Smart Energy Meter through IOT.
India is the third largest country in the world interns of its electricity consumption. The average electrical energy per capita is 1181 units/person/year and its average power per capita is about 140 W/person. There are many power distribution companies both government and private sectors are involved in distributing the power to the consumers. Few decades before personnel from power distribution companies have been measured the electricity consumption manually by visiting the consumer’s site and the billing has been made. In this method, manual errors are unavoidable. Also it allows some illegal billing which favors to some consumers. Nowadays, existing energy meters are replaced with smart electrical energy meters and the electricity units consumption is measured through the specific device once in a month or bimonthly. The error free unit consumption has been recorded in this method. However the electricity consumption and billing amount has been recorded and published only once in a month or bimonthly. If the consumers more electricity during certain days in a month, the same is known at the time of billing. Hence, there is a possibility of conflict occurs between consumers and power distribution companies and also no energy saving potential opportunity in this method. Even though the smart energy meters are installed, it is not utilized adequately since the absence of integrating smart meters with IOT.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
The problem mentioned in the back ground can be solved by Developing of an Intelligent Mobile Application Integrated with Smart Energy Meter through IOT.
The aim of the invention is to develop an intelligent mobile application suitable to electricity consumers for promoting energy savings, providing transparency and preventing the conflict between consumers and power distribution organization. This mobile application is integrated with the smart energy meters installed at the consumers end and through which parameters such as current, voltage, power, energy, power factor and maximum demand are measured and the measured data are transmitted to the cloud through Internet of Things (IoT). Data stored in the cloud is accessed by the mobile in which the application is used. The measurement and transmission are happened at least once in an hour. This provision of instantaneous recording and communicating data offers the possibility to the consumers to aware the electricity consumption and the billing amount. Apart, using this application one can set the maximum limit of electricity consumption according their wish. This application includes the provision of alerting the consumers if the fixed maximum limit of electricity consumption is reached. This exclusive feature helps in minimizing the electricity consumption by consumers and planning accordingly. This ensures the possible energy savings in the utility side. This application ensures the transparency of electricity bill and other data and it is drastically preventing the conflict between consumers and power distribution companies. Therefore customer satisfaction can be greatly achieved through this intelligent mobile application.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
The FIG 1 shows a complete view of the complete view of an Intelligent Mobile Application Integrated with Smart Energy Meter through IOT. At the consumer/ utility side (101) the smart energy meter (102) is installed. This smart energy meter has the facility of measuring the various electrical parameters at the bus bar where it is connected. The various electrical parameters are current, voltage, power, energy, power factor and maximum demand. These data are sending through the transmitter (103) to the cloud database (104). This cloud retain the data and whenever required that can be fetched from it. Both recording and transmitting the data happened in hourly basis. These data are obtained by the mobile phone (105) in which the application (107) is installed through its receiver (106).
